What's The Definition Of Antiheroine?
antiheroine in American English
a female antihero noun: a female protagonist, as in a novel or play, whose attitudes and behavior are not typical of a conventional heroine antiheroine in British English noun: a central female character in a novel, play, film, etc, who lacks the traditional heroic virtues |
